Ranger Energy Services (RNGR) Scheduled to Post Earnings on Tuesday

Ranger Energy Services (NYSE:RNGRGet Free Report) is set to post its quarterly earnings results before the market opens on Tuesday, May 7th. Ranger Energy Services (NYSE:RNGRG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, March 5th. The company reported $0.09 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.33 by ($0.24). Ranger Energy Services had a return on equity of 8.67% and a net margin of 3.74%. The firm had revenue of $151.50 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$151.00 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ted $0.30 earnings per share. On average, analysts expect Ranger Energy Services to post $1 EPS for the current fiscal year and $1 EPS for the next fiscal year.

Ranger Energy Services Stock Up 1.1 %

Shares of Ranger Energy Services stock opened at $10.05 on Friday. Ranger Energy Services has a 52-week low of $9.27 and a 52-week high of $14.64. The company has a market capitalization of $227.76 million, a P/E ratio of 10.47 and a beta of 0.66. The company has a 50 day moving average of $11.01 and a 200 day moving average of $10.72.

Ranger Energy Services Announces Dividend

The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, April 5th. Stockholders of record on Friday, March 15th were issued a $0.05 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Thursday, March 14th. This represents a $0.20 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.99%. Ranger Energy Services’s payout ratio is 20.83%.

Ranger Energy Services Company Profile

Ranger Energy Services, Inc provides onshore high specification well service rigs, wireline services, and complementary services to exploration and production companies in the United States. It operates through three segments: High Specification Rigs, Wireline Services, and Processing Solutions and Ancillary Services.
